Frequently Asked Questions about Greater Central
What type of rentals are currently available in Greater Central?
There are currently 525 Apartments for Rent in Greater Central, MN with pricing that ranges from $653 to $11,439. There are also 44 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Greater Central ranging from $1,195 to $6,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Greater Central?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Greater Central ranges from $1,195 to $6,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,329.
